Sense 1
Sabine, Sabine River -- (a river in eastern Texas that flows south into the Gulf of Mexico)
INSTANCE OF=> river -- (a large natural stream of water (larger than a creek); "the river was navigable for 50 miles")
Sense 2
Sabine -- (a member of an ancient Oscan-speaking people of the central Apennines north of Rome who were conquered and assimilated into the Roman state in 290 BC)
=> Italian -- (a native or inhabitant of Italy)
